ABSTRACT
Objective:To identify the risk factors for early acute lung injury (ALI) after living-related liver transplantation in pediatric patients and evaluate the value of the risk factors in prediction of ALI.Methods:Perioperative data of patients were obtained through the electronic medical records system. Patients were divided into non-ALI group and ALI group according to whether ALI occurred within the first week after surgery. The risk factors of which P values were less than 0.05 would enter the multiple logistic regression analysis to stratify ALI-related risk factors. Area under the ROC curve was used to analyze the value of the risk factors in prediction of postoperative ALI. Results:A total of 67 patients were enrolled, including 45 cases in non-ALI group and 22 cases in ALI group. Increased intraoperative blood transfusion volume and up-regulated expression of miR-122 and miR-21 were independent risk factors for the occurrence of postoperative ALI ( P<0.05), and the area under the ROC curve (95% confidence interval) of serum miR-122 and miR-21 expression was 0.946 (0.875 to 1.00), with sensitivity and specificity of 95% and 90%, respectively. Conclusions:Increased intraoperative blood transfusion volume and up-regulated expression of serum miR-122 and miR-21 are independent risk factors for early postoperative ALI, and serum miR-122 and miR-21 levels have a high value in prediction of the development of postoperative ALI in pediatric patients undergoing living-related liver transplantation.
